Prof. Pawel Danielewicz (East Lansing, MSU (USA))24/03/2014, 09:50Constraints on the nuclear equation of state, following from heavy ion collisions and from structure, are reviewed. The collisions produce matter transiently reaching densities few times the normal. Isolating observables testing such densities is challenging, though, and interpretation of those observables suffers from theoretical uncertainities. Dr Juergen Schaffner-Bielich (Institut fuer Theoretische Physik, Goethe Universitaet, Frankfurt)24/03/2014, 10:30In the dense interior of compact stars the composition might change considerably. Due to weak equilibrium in neutron star matter particles carrying strangeness can appear changing the overall global properties as well as the transport properties of compact stars.
